It welcomes itself to sit on your roofing and triggers unpleasant discoloration. It's algae and it results a lot of property owners, particularly those who live in areas of high humidity. It will connect to any roofing and can be carried through wind, squirrels, birds, and so on.
The Copper Concept
The principle behind algae resistant roofing system shingles is really rather simple. The copper isn't visible, however it's presence is certainly felt by unwary algae as it is unable to survive on your roof's surface. The copper or zinc present in algae resistant shingles are triggered even more by rain, which disperses the algae battling elements even further along the roofing system's surface area.

In order to prevent discarding cash on short-term repairs, you must understand precisely how flat roof systems are created, the different types of flat roofs that are readily available, and the significance of routine evaluation and upkeep.
A flat roof system works by offering a water resistant membrane over a building. It includes several layers of hydrophobic materials that is placed over a structural deck with a vapor barrier that is normally put between roofing system membrane.
Flashing, or thin strips of product such as copper, converge with the membrane and the other building elements to avoid water infiltration. The water is then directed to drains, downspouts, and rain gutters by the roofing's small pitch.
There are four most typical kinds of flat roofing systems. Noted in order of increasing toughness and expense, they are: roll asphalt, single-ply membrane, built-up or multiple-ply, and flat-seamed metal. They can range anywhere from as low as $2 per square foot for roll asphalt or single-ply roof that is used over and existing roofing system, to $20 per square foot or more for new metal roofing systems.
Utilized since the 1890s, asphalt roll roofing usually consists of one layer of asphalt-saturated organic or fiberglass base felts that are used over roofing system felt with nails and cold asphalt cement and typically covered with a granular mineral surface. The joints are generally covered over with a roof substance. It can last about 10 years.
Single-ply membrane roof is the latest kind of roofing material. It is typically utilized to change multiple-ply roofings. 10 to 12 year guarantees are normal, however correct installation is vital and maintenance is still needed.
Multiple-ply or built-up roof, likewise referred to as BUR, is made of overlapping rolls of saturated or covered felts or mats that are interspersed with layers of bitumen and surfaced with a granular roof tile, ballast, or sheet pavers that are utilized to protect the hidden materials from the weather. BURs are designed to last 10 to 30 years, which depends on the materials used.
Ballast, or aggregate, of crushed stone or water-worn gravel is embedded in a finishing of asphalt or coal tar. Considering that the ballast or tile pavers cover the membrane, it makes checking and preserving the joints of the roofing difficult.
Finally, flat-seamed roofs have been used considering that the 19 th century. Made from small pieces of sheet metal soldered flush at the joints, it can last many years depending upon the quality of the maintenance, product, and direct exposure to the elements.
Galvanized metal does require routine painting in order to avoid rust and split seams need to be resoldered. Other metal surface areas, such as copper, can end up being pitted and pinholed from acid raid and typically needs replacing. Today copper, lead-coated copper, and terne-coated stainless steel are preferred as long-lasting flat roofings.
